MFA
CINEMA WEEKLY is a weekly program
presented by the Miami Film Association & The Oxford
Community Arts Center, featuring new, un-released, independent
films. Films will be screened at 7:30pm each Wednesday in
the main theater at the OCAC in Oxford, OH. Each week a new
independent feature film and short film will be screened for
the public in the main 200-seat theater of the historic Oxford
Community Arts Center, with brand-new high-definition digital
projection and audio. These are great new films that you can't
see anywhere else! Films selected are chosen from a pool of
over 1000 brand-new independent films received each year by
the Miami Film Association. Each night there will
be a time to sit and chat "film" with popcorn, snacks,
coffee, and (once a month) live music! This is a great evening
for indie-film enthusiasts and filmmakers a-like! Stay tuned,

SUBMITTING
A FILM...
If you are an independent filmmaker and would like your work
considered for screening in MFA CINEMA WEEKLY send your original,
un-released film (short or feature, of any length or genre,
from any country) to us on NTSC DVD
(R-1 or R-0) with a press kit or short synopsis and complete
contact information (address, phone, e-mail) on all
materials to MIAMI FILM ASSOCIATION,
ATTN: CINEMA WEEKLY, PO BOX 492, OXFORD, OH 45056, USA
